Let \(q=p^\alpha \) for a prime \(p\ge 3\) and a positive integer \(\alpha \) , let \(\mathbb Z_q^*\) be a reduced residue system modulo q, k be an integer with \( k \mid \phi (q)\) . The purpose of this paper is to give an asymptotic property for \(N_{k}(n, q)\) , the number of representations of any element \(n\in \mathbb Z_q^*\) as sum of a primitive root and a k-th residue in \(\mathbb Z_q^*\) . In addition, we consider the square mean value of the error term of \(N_{2}(n, p)\) in this short note.
